[发明专利]机械的控制装置在审
申请号: | 202010205857.2 | 申请日: | 2020-03-23 |
公开(公告)号: | CN111736522A | 公开(公告)日: | 2020-10-02 |
发明(设计)人: | 大仓拓磨 | 申请(专利权)人: | 发那科株式会社 |
主分类号: | G05B19/19 | 分类号: | G05B19/19;G01D5/245 |
代理公司: | 北京林达刘知识产权代理事务所(普通合伙) 11277 | 代理人: | 刘新宇 |
地址: | 日本*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 机械 控制 装置 | ||
本发明提供一种机械的控制装置,能够不依赖于检测器的数据长度地、基于从检测器输出的转数数据来检测绝对位置。机械的控制装置(10)使用用于输出与检测对象的位置对应的转数数据的检测器来检测检测对象的绝对位置,并基于检测出的检测对象的绝对位置来控制机械,该机械的控制装置具备:存储部,其将检测器的与绝对位置的原点位置对应的转数数据存储为原点位置数据,将超出检测器能够输出的转数数据长度的转数数据存储为扩展转数数据;以及运算部,其通过基于从检测器输出的转数数据、原点位置数据及扩展转数数据的下式(1),来计算绝对位置,绝对位置=(来自检测器的转数数据+扩展转数数据)‑原点位置数据···(1)。
技术领域
本发明涉及一种机床或产业用机器人等机械的控制装置。
背景技术
机床或产业用机器人等机械的控制装置使用用于输出与检测对象的位置对应的转数数据的检测器来检测检测对象的绝对位置,并基于检测出的检测对象的绝对位置来控制机械(例如参照专利文献1)。
专利文献1:日本特开2000-99156号公报
发明内容
如图8所示,检测绝对位置的检测器具有计数器值(转数数据及旋转一周内的转数数据)。控制装置保持检测器的与绝对位置的原点位置对应的计数器值,并根据检测器的当前位置处的计数器值与检测器的原点位置的计数器值之差来计算绝对位置(例如机械坐标)。
检测器的计数器值的数据长度(转数数据长度)根据检测器的种类而不同。
如图9所示,在检测器的数据长度短的情况下,通过绝对位置检测能够表现的绝对位置(例如机械坐标值)变窄,能够应用的机械受到限定。在图9中,作为检测器的数据长度,示出以原点位置为中心的±数据长度/2。
超出检测器的数据长度的位置无法通过检测器来表现,因此无法计算正确的绝对位置(例如机械坐标值)。
在机械的控制装置的领域,期望能够不依赖检测器的数据长度地、基于从检测器输出的转数数据来检测绝对位置。
本公开的机械的控制装置使用用于输出与检测对象的位置对应的转数数据的检测器来检测所述检测对象的绝对位置,并基于检测出的所述检测对象的绝对位置来控制机械,所述机械的控制装置具备:存储部,其将所述检测器的与所述绝对位置的原点位置对应的转数数据存储为原点位置数据,将超出所述检测器能够输出的转数数据长度的转数数据存储为扩展转数数据;以及运算部,其通过基于从所述检测器输出的转数数据、所述原点位置数据及所述扩展转数数据的下式(1),来计算所述绝对位置,
绝对位置=(来自检测器的转数数据+扩展转数数据)-原点位置数据···(1)。
本公开的其它的机械的控制装置使用用于输出与检测对象的位置对应的转数数据的检测器来检测所述检测对象的绝对位置,并基于检测出的所述检测对象的绝对位置来控制机械,所述机械的控制装置具备:存储部,其将所述检测器的与所述绝对位置的原点位置对应的转数数据存储为原点位置数据,在将超出所述检测器能够输出的转数数据长度的转数数据设为扩展转数数据的情况下,所述存储部存储将所述原点位置数据移位所述扩展转数数据而得到的移位原点位置数据;以及运算部,其通过基于所述移位原点位置数据及从所述检测器输出的转数数据的下式(2),来计算所述绝对位置,
绝对位置=来自检测器的转数数据-移位原点位置数据
=来自检测器的转数数据-(原点位置数据-扩展转数数据)···(2)。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于发那科株式会社,未经发那科株式会社许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010205857.2/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种多功能骨科临床体位可调控支架
- 下一篇:显示面板